2 June 2006 Forest Gate Raid - Cultural References

Cultural References

  • In the Channel 4 Mini-series Britz, the Muslim British protagonist agrees to work for the MI5 and to carry through incursions and other privacy-invading actions to collect evidence from suspected terrorists, but solely under the condition that the evidence supplied against them is adequate and trustworthy. He proceeds to directly reference the Forest Gate Incident as a case where it was not.
